Output ef25ae4fa36867174f13054c80b7502a0f2671d16acc12a531d8f1ce8cd3723e:0

value
1077136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d20cdfd380ac84468ada8d6151d0415c35b0f1 OP_EQUAL
address
37bkoNU4qzaiXZHfmZaPAVHPx3XeSr73Pp
transaction
ef25ae4fa36867174f13054c80b7502a0f2671d16acc12a531d8f1ce8cd3723e
spent
true